Kri Skincare Endless Moisturiser Review:

Oh how I adore Kri.  This brand specializes in gentle vegan friendly treatments that are ideal for sensitive skin types, but I also find they are perfect for all.  While I love both of their moisturizing products, I find that Endless tips the scale for me in terms of favourites.   Endless contains hyaluronic acid for a super boost of hydration, squalane to replenish and soften, and jojoba oil which gives an extra dose of moisture.  This face cream was designed to deliver a silky smooth finish, and the fragrance free formula ensures your skin remains calm and is given the relief it needs.  Kri offers an intensive formula that looks and feels so full when it is first pumped out, yet it is more like a second skin once applied.  And you can feel the difference in your skin's texture as it brings an immediate lift to the area.  This is certainly a special product, and one that I always recommend to anyone searching for a solution for their combination skin.

Terre Verdi Neroli Pom Moisturiser Review:

One of my first successful finds for a moisturizer that suited my blemish prone and semi sensitive skin was the Neroli Pom Moisturizer from Terre Verdi.  I first tried a sample years and years ago after getting one in an edit of the Freedm Street subscription box, and I then got a full size bottle to see if the magical vegan friendly cream was as good as I thought.  It was!  Never have I tried a formula that is so lightweight while also delivering a high level of nourishment.  NeroliPom is technically formulated for dry or mature skin, but it doesn't clog pores or leave the face feeling greasy at all.  The cream is a dream - light, smooth, fully absorbing, and satin-soft.  White tea, pomegranate seed oil, aloe vera powder, and neroli flower oil work together to make an antioxidant packed moisturizer that is both soothing and wholesome.  It's one of the best, and that's why it remains a favourite to this day!

O Moi Plump It Up Face Cream Review:

A discovery made when judging in the Beauty Shortlist Awards, O Moi is a Danish brand that quickly wowed me with their fabulous face cream.  They have created something really unique with almost colour shifting properties to it and a transfixing scent that uplifts and calms the mind.  In the pot, the Plump It Up Face Cream looks incredibly rich, thick, and like it would be combination skin's worst nightmare.  But that couldn't be further from the truth.  With a brilliant balance of hydration and moisture, O Moi offers a surprisingly light finish, an instant plumping effect, and creates an effect where the skin feels nourished, silky soft, and looks so healthy.  The blend of hyaluronic acid, dragon's blood, pomegranate, camellia, shea, and cocoa is rejuvenating and intensive, and it delivers a huge boost to the face without leading to oily residues or unwanted spots.  Definitely a keeper, and one I was thrilled to stumble upon.

Pamoja Revive Multi-action Face Cream Review:

A more recent addition to my list of best natural moisturizers for combination skin is the vegan friendly Revive Multi-action Face Cream from Pamoja.   Unlike so many other formulas that proved to be either too heavy, melt off, or break me out, this one posed no such issues.  Crafted to deliver relief for tight and irritated skin and increased elasticity, this treatment provides instant hydration and is a total dream to use.  Again, this one looks super rich in the jar, but once you begin to massage into the face you realize it is actually pretty airy and feels lightweight.  No congested pores, no irritation, and no greasy residue - just plumped up and less redness in the cheeks!   The mix of red raspberry seed, marula, cacay, and sunflower oil along with murumuru seed butter give this balance and helps make this a fab face cream for all skin types and all seasons, and it is one I have loved ever since I got my first pot.

Skn-RG Advanced Brightening Moisturiser Review:

Another formula that has been added to my favourites list is from science meets nature brand Skn-RG.  Their Advanced Brightening Moisturiser is a game changing vegan treatment as it pioneers a combination of actives called Ultra Luminance Complex.  The special blend of Vitamin C, B3, Zinc, MSM, Aminos and AHA’s work to tone, smooth, and brighten, and the base of apple and raspberry oils, hyaluronic acid, and prebiotics ensure soothing and healing benefits.  This cream is emollient, and while it feels fairly slick to start out with it actually ends up being super lightweight and is perfect for acne-prone and combination skin types since it doesn't leave any heavy residue and it's bursting with antioxidants.  While the scent isn't my favourite, the experience as a whole is excellent since your face is left looking brighter, tighter, and restored.

PHB Gentle Moisturiser Review:

PHB has been a long time love of mine, and their Gentle Moisturiser has consistently been on my beauty shelf since I first tried it many years ago.  This is a simple solution for those needing a small boost without any added essential oils or overly rich ingredients.  It's not intensively nourishing, but it works to heal with a vegan friendly mix of aloe, shea, apricot, and sunflower.  The hypoallergenic formula has a vaguely sweet and nutty aroma if you breathe in deeply, but overall the face cream is the ultimate subtle treatment.  I love that it absorbs so well, and it doesn't cling to the skin or leave it feeling sticky or weighed down, and I find myself reaching for this bottle when I need a break from a full ritual as I can trust it will maintain the fresh and healthy appearance without the need for lots of other products.
